One Rate.
On What You Route.
You keep your own provider contracts and keep paying OpenAI, Anthropic, or Gemini directly. SecuriX charges 3% of the spend that passes through the gateway — and prices the volume directly once you are routing more than $50,000 a month. No markup on tokens. No fee per employee.
Plus a $499 monthly platform fee — you pay whichever is greater. Sign up, connect your provider key, and route traffic the same day.

Everything Is in the Price.
There is one plan. Governance is not a premium tier, because a gateway without policy is not worth deploying.
- LLM gateway across OpenAI, Anthropic, and Azure OpenAI
- Employee chat portal with SSO (SAML) and SCIM provisioning
- Prompt and response audit log, retained and exportable
- Per-user, per-team, and per-model cost attribution
- Team and department budgets enforced at the gateway
- DLP redaction on requests and responses
- MCP server with Rego policy on every tool call
- Model whitelisting and role-based access
- Anomaly detection and usage alerting
- Deployment support and a named point of contact
- Per user, per seat, or per employee
- A markup on provider tokens — you pay them directly
- Separate fees per connected tool or integration
- Extra for SSO, audit logs, or policy enforcement
Because billing follows usage rather than headcount, extending AI to more of your organisation does not increase what you pay us. Compare against per-seat licensing.

Questions About Pricing
What exactly does the 3% apply to?
It applies to the provider spend routed through the gateway — the amount you are already billed by OpenAI, Anthropic, or Azure for that traffic. If you route $20,000 of provider usage in a month, the gateway fee is 3% of that. We never resell tokens or mark them up, so your provider invoice is unchanged.
Why bring our own provider keys instead of buying tokens from you?
Because it keeps your commercial relationship and your data agreements with the provider intact. Your legal team has already reviewed those terms, your negotiated rates and committed-use discounts still apply, and there is no third party reselling inference to you. It also means you can leave without renegotiating anything with your model provider.
What is the platform minimum for?
The gateway runs whether you send one request or a million: identity, policy evaluation, audit retention, and support all carry fixed cost. The monthly minimum of $499 covers that floor. Once 3% of your routed spend exceeds it, the minimum stops applying and you simply pay the percentage.
Is the MCP server included?
Yes. The MCP server and its Rego policy layer are part of the platform, not a separate line item. Tool access is where most of the real governance risk sits, so charging extra for it would be charging extra for the point of the product.
What happens above $50,000 a month?
Past that point a flat percentage stops being sensible for either side, so we price the volume directly against a commitment. That conversation also covers self-hosted or private VPC deployment, security review, and a named contact. Send us your approximate monthly spend and we will reply with a rate.
Does the rate change as we grow?
Not on the standard plan — the percentage is flat, so cost scales linearly with what you route. Beyond the enterprise threshold we move you onto negotiated pricing, which works out lower rather than higher.
How are we billed?
Monthly in arrears, against metered usage you can see in the dashboard at any point in the cycle. Every figure on the invoice is traceable to per-user and per-team attribution, so finance can allocate cost back to the business units that incurred it.
